    The architecture of GlobalPayCCSE is multifaceted, involving various components that work together to ensure smooth and secure transactions. These components may include payment gateways, fraud detection systems, currency conversion modules, and compliance tools. Payment gateways act as intermediaries between the merchant and the payment processor, securely transmitting transaction data. Fraud detection systems employ sophisticated algorithms to identify and prevent fraudulent activities, safeguarding both the merchant and the customer. Currency conversion modules automatically convert currencies at the prevailing exchange rates, simplifying the payment process for international transactions. Compliance tools ensure that all transactions adhere to relevant regulations and standards, such as PCI DSS and GDPR.

    Fraud prevention mechanisms are essential for protecting businesses and customers from fraudulent transactions. GlobalPayCCSE employs a variety of fraud detection tools, such as address verification systems (AVS), card verification value (CVV) checks, and advanced fraud detection algorithms. AVS verifies the billing address provided by the customer against the address on file with the card issuer, while CVV checks verify the three- or four-digit security code on the back of the card. Advanced fraud detection algorithms analyze transaction data in real-time to identify suspicious patterns and prevent fraudulent activities. These measures help to minimize the risk of fraud and protect businesses from financial losses.

    Encryption is a fundamental security measure that protects sensitive data from unauthorized access. GlobalPayCCSE uses encryption technologies, such as SSL and TLS, to encrypt data during transmission, preventing eavesdropping and data breaches. Encryption algorithms scramble the data, making it unreadable to anyone who does not have the decryption key. This ensures that sensitive information, such as credit card numbers and personal data, remains confidential and protected. Furthermore, encryption is used to secure data at rest, protecting it from unauthorized access even if it is stored on a server or database.

    Tokenization is a security technique that replaces sensitive data with non-sensitive tokens. These tokens can be used to process payments without exposing the actual credit card numbers or personal information. Tokenization helps to prevent data breaches and fraud, as even if the tokens are compromised, they cannot be used to access the underlying sensitive data. Tokenization is particularly useful for e-commerce businesses, as it allows them to store customer payment information securely without having to worry about data breaches. Furthermore, tokenization simplifies compliance with PCI DSS, as it reduces the scope of the compliance requirements.

    Fraud monitoring is a critical security measure that helps to identify and prevent fraudulent transactions in real-time. GlobalPayCCSE employs advanced fraud detection algorithms that analyze transaction data to identify suspicious patterns and prevent fraudulent activities. These algorithms consider factors such as the transaction amount, location, time of day, and customer history to assess the risk of fraud. If a suspicious transaction is detected, it is flagged for further review and may be blocked to prevent fraud. Furthermore, fraud monitoring systems provide businesses with alerts and reports, enabling them to track fraud trends and improve their fraud prevention strategies.
